<r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Hacker News: davidjnelson</title><link>https://news.ycombinator.com/user?id=davidjnelson</link><description>Hacker News RSS</description><docs>https://hnrss.org/</docs><generator>hnrss v2.1.1</generator><lastBuildDate>Thu, 30 Apr 2026 10:15:28 +0000</lastBuildDate><atom:link href="https://hnrss.org/user?id=davidjnelson" rel="self" type="application/rss+xml"></atom:link><item><title><![CDATA[Building the Future of Spotify Desktop Apps]]></title><description><![CDATA[
<p>Article URL: <a href="https://engineering.atspotify.com/2021/04/07/building-the-future-of-our-desktop-apps">https://engineering.atspotify.com/2021/04/07/building-the-future-of-our-desktop-apps</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=27297289">https://news.ycombinator.com/item?id=27297289</a></p>
<p>Points: 2</p>
<p># Comments: 0</p>
]]></description><pubDate>Wed, 26 May 2021 23:12:20 +0000</pubDate><link>https://engineering.atspotify.com/2021/04/07/building-the-future-of-our-desktop-apps</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=27297289</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=27297289</guid></item><item><title><![CDATA[New comment by davidjnelson in "Tell HN: Aaron Swartz died today, 8 years ago"]]></title><description><![CDATA[
<p>Really sad.  Rest In Peace Aaron.</p>
]]></description><pubDate>Mon, 11 Jan 2021 19:17:28 +0000</pubDate><link>https://news.ycombinator.com/item?id=25734646</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25734646</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25734646</guid></item><item><title><![CDATA[New comment by davidjnelson in "OpenSocial Specification"]]></title><description><![CDATA[
<p>We built a really cool enterprise social network with this at Autodesk 10+ years ago.</p>
]]></description><pubDate>Mon, 11 Jan 2021 19:15:36 +0000</pubDate><link>https://news.ycombinator.com/item?id=25734603</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25734603</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25734603</guid></item><item><title><![CDATA[Kuma: The platform that powers MDN]]></title><description><![CDATA[
<p>Article URL: <a href="https://github.com/mdn/kuma">https://github.com/mdn/kuma</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=25655509">https://news.ycombinator.com/item?id=25655509</a></p>
<p>Points: 3</p>
<p># Comments: 0</p>
]]></description><pubDate>Wed, 06 Jan 2021 07:49:03 +0000</pubDate><link>https://github.com/mdn/kuma</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25655509</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25655509</guid></item><item><title><![CDATA[New comment by davidjnelson in "IntelliJ Idea 2020.3.1 Is Out with Apple Silicon Support"]]></title><description><![CDATA[
<p>That’s exciting, I was just looking at the status of this yesterday.</p>
]]></description><pubDate>Wed, 30 Dec 2020 19:49:12 +0000</pubDate><link>https://news.ycombinator.com/item?id=25585245</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25585245</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25585245</guid></item><item><title><![CDATA[New comment by davidjnelson in "How We Built the GitHub Globe"]]></title><description><![CDATA[
<p>Their home page is really a work of art, just beautiful.</p>
]]></description><pubDate>Wed, 30 Dec 2020 19:47:05 +0000</pubDate><link>https://news.ycombinator.com/item?id=25585223</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25585223</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25585223</guid></item><item><title><![CDATA[MIT Better World Gathering Talks]]></title><description><![CDATA[
<p>Article URL: <a href="https://betterworld.mit.edu/stories/stars-brains-and-enzymes-a-celebration-of-mit-science/?device=mobile">https://betterworld.mit.edu/stories/stars-brains-and-enzymes-a-celebration-of-mit-science/?device=mobile</a></p>
<p>Comments URL: <a href="https://news.ycombinator.com/item?id=25461442">https://news.ycombinator.com/item?id=25461442</a></p>
<p>Points: 1</p>
<p># Comments: 0</p>
]]></description><pubDate>Thu, 17 Dec 2020 22:37:53 +0000</pubDate><link>https://betterworld.mit.edu/stories/stars-brains-and-enzymes-a-celebration-of-mit-science/?device=mobile</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25461442</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25461442</guid></item><item><title><![CDATA[New comment by davidjnelson in "Stimulus.js 2.0"]]></title><description><![CDATA[
<p>yup, and if you want to really optimize it you could use functions as a service like lambda as your react rendering layer, which forwards to heroku or fargate or beanstalk or vanilla ec2 or whatever for your backend.<p>and if cloudflare workers ever support metered usage you could use that too for the react layer.<p>and if you want hyper performance you could use lambda@edge and intelligently route to your backend running on fly.io to minimize the distance.  the somewhat unsolved problem there though is multi region master master replicated databases which are cost effective.<p>to my knowledge this is the current state of the art for that <a href="https://docs.aws.amazon.com/AmazonRDS/latest/AuroraUserGuide/aurora-multi-master.html" rel="nofollow">https://docs.aws.amazon.com/AmazonRDS/latest/AuroraUserGuide...</a><p>problem is you have to pay for each region so it's not really cost effective.</p>
]]></description><pubDate>Mon, 07 Dec 2020 01:21:41 +0000</pubDate><link>https://news.ycombinator.com/item?id=25328442</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25328442</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25328442</guid></item><item><title><![CDATA[New comment by davidjnelson in "Stimulus.js 2.0"]]></title><description><![CDATA[
<p>hey if stimulus and turbolinks are your jam then rock it!<p>I would at least give this a look though, it's super easy to use: <a href="https://github.com/shakacode/react_on_rails" rel="nofollow">https://github.com/shakacode/react_on_rails</a></p>
]]></description><pubDate>Mon, 07 Dec 2020 01:16:00 +0000</pubDate><link>https://news.ycombinator.com/item?id=25328400</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25328400</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25328400</guid></item><item><title><![CDATA[New comment by davidjnelson in "Stimulus.js 2.0"]]></title><description><![CDATA[
<p>Ya it really depends.  I like redis and Postgres generally speaking for data, and Ruby on Rails generally for business logic.  And you can certainly do universal rendering with that easily with react_on_rails.  If you do end up needing more perf, maybe go would be interesting.</p>
]]></description><pubDate>Sat, 05 Dec 2020 21:27:58 +0000</pubDate><link>https://news.ycombinator.com/item?id=25318551</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25318551</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25318551</guid></item><item><title><![CDATA[New comment by davidjnelson in "“I've had to relearn coding to get through the new interviews”"]]></title><description><![CDATA[
<p>Wow that’s fascinating and insightful!  Stripe sounds like such an awesome company.  Congratulations on getting an offer from them, psyched for you!!!</p>
]]></description><pubDate>Sat, 05 Dec 2020 21:23:59 +0000</pubDate><link>https://news.ycombinator.com/item?id=25318509</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25318509</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25318509</guid></item><item><title><![CDATA[New comment by davidjnelson in "Stimulus.js 2.0"]]></title><description><![CDATA[
<p>Rails is dope.  And it works really well with universal react rendering if you need that with react_on_rails.</p>
]]></description><pubDate>Sat, 05 Dec 2020 01:52:16 +0000</pubDate><link>https://news.ycombinator.com/item?id=25310864</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25310864</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25310864</guid></item><item><title><![CDATA[New comment by davidjnelson in "Stimulus.js 2.0"]]></title><description><![CDATA[
<p>Ya depends on what you’re doing.  Webpack is worth mastering though in general.</p>
]]></description><pubDate>Sat, 05 Dec 2020 01:48:13 +0000</pubDate><link>https://news.ycombinator.com/item?id=25310840</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25310840</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25310840</guid></item><item><title><![CDATA[New comment by davidjnelson in "Stimulus.js 2.0"]]></title><description><![CDATA[
<p>True, that’s not its use case.</p>
]]></description><pubDate>Sat, 05 Dec 2020 01:46:25 +0000</pubDate><link>https://news.ycombinator.com/item?id=25310828</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25310828</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25310828</guid></item><item><title><![CDATA[New comment by davidjnelson in "Stimulus.js 2.0"]]></title><description><![CDATA[
<p>React supports server side rendering.</p>
]]></description><pubDate>Fri, 04 Dec 2020 22:52:25 +0000</pubDate><link>https://news.ycombinator.com/item?id=25309396</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25309396</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25309396</guid></item><item><title><![CDATA[New comment by davidjnelson in "Stimulus.js 2.0"]]></title><description><![CDATA[
<p>React is great though, why not just use that?</p>
]]></description><pubDate>Fri, 04 Dec 2020 22:41:41 +0000</pubDate><link>https://news.ycombinator.com/item?id=25309278</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25309278</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25309278</guid></item><item><title><![CDATA[New comment by davidjnelson in "“I've had to relearn coding to get through the new interviews”"]]></title><description><![CDATA[
<p>Is this faang / levels.fyi pay range?</p>
]]></description><pubDate>Fri, 04 Dec 2020 16:36:04 +0000</pubDate><link>https://news.ycombinator.com/item?id=25304292</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25304292</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25304292</guid></item><item><title><![CDATA[New comment by davidjnelson in "“I've had to relearn coding to get through the new interviews”"]]></title><description><![CDATA[
<p>> So let's not lose our excitement and sense of wonder<p>Exactly.  It’s wild the potential that many of us hold.</p>
]]></description><pubDate>Fri, 04 Dec 2020 16:32:40 +0000</pubDate><link>https://news.ycombinator.com/item?id=25304240</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25304240</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25304240</guid></item><item><title><![CDATA[New comment by davidjnelson in "“I've had to relearn coding to get through the new interviews”"]]></title><description><![CDATA[
<p>Sounds reasonable.  Thing is, these companies pay, and this is what they do.  So if you want to play there, you have to play the game their way.</p>
]]></description><pubDate>Fri, 04 Dec 2020 16:29:28 +0000</pubDate><link>https://news.ycombinator.com/item?id=25304186</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25304186</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25304186</guid></item><item><title><![CDATA[New comment by davidjnelson in "“I've had to relearn coding to get through the new interviews”"]]></title><description><![CDATA[
<p>Talk to people you know.  Should help find a job without the inane interviews.  Blessings to you friend.</p>
]]></description><pubDate>Fri, 04 Dec 2020 16:23:48 +0000</pubDate><link>https://news.ycombinator.com/item?id=25304103</link><dc:creator>davidjnelson</dc:creator><comments>https://news.ycombinator.com/item?id=25304103</comments><guid isPermaLink="false">https://news.ycombinator.com/item?id=25304103</guid></item></channel></rss>